Gloria Kniss
Gloria works with the director and the assistant director of the Master of Arts in Education program, Lancaster, in planning, coordinating, and implementing components of the education program including special events, classes, and publications. Specific assignments and administrative responsibilities include maintaining and updating the Lancaster masters in education student database, files, and records, managing office operations and tasks as assigned, corresponding with students and faculty, and giving timely responses to requests for information. She welcomes visitors, instructors and students, prepares and distributes information for classes, and handles registration and payments for classes. She also maintains the Lancaster library/resource area. She has one son, James Paul, at Lancaster Mennonite High School, and is involved at Mount Joy Mennonite Church. Gloria is a graduate of Eastern Mennonite University.
